Extrajudicial Killings: A Dangerous Precedent?

This chapter examines the implications of extrajudicial killings in the context of international law, highlighting issues of national sovereignty and potential global precedents. It critically assesses the ethical and legal ramifications of targeting individuals labeled as terrorists in foreign countries, while analyzing the motivations and justifications presented by leaders for such actions.
